Care and longevity payoffs

Good care protects fabric hand, color depth, and shape retention. Launder cool, turn garments inside out, and skip overdrying. Hang to dry flat or on a hanger to keep drape.

Dense knits work well to delicate cycles and low heat if you must tumble; high temperature is what destroys rib and shrinks bodies. Use a steamer instead of a scorching iron to keep surface texture intact. A pill shaver eliminates the occasional pill on stress zones without thinning the cloth. Rotate heavy pieces in your daily lineup so construction recover fully between uses. Handling garments like equipment rather than disposables enhances cost-per-wear advantages over time.
